PLEASE NOTE: This page is a draft. It is thus in an unfinished state and may feature broken and/or incorrect formatting.

This page lists all the music in MediEvil. All tracks were composed by Paul Arnold and Andrew Barnabas.

28

Template:Infobox songJingle 7 can be heard in the background of the Hall of Heroes track. However, it is part of the track and the separate jingle is never played anywhere in the game, with the exception of the Italian (SCES-01494) and Spanish (SCES-01495) releases, where it replaces the Game Over jingle.

Demo tracklist

This section lists all the music tracks used in early demo versions of the game.

1G14 (Demo)

Template:Infobox songA shorter version of IG14 (Journey through the Crystal Caves). In the MediEvil Rolling Demo, the track was used in The Hilltop Mausoleum, The Haunted Ruins, and The Ghost Ship levels. In the MediEvil 0.32 Demo, the track was used in the title level.

1G7 (Demo)

Template:Infobox songA shorter version of 1G7 (A difficult path). In the MediEvil Rolling Demo, the track was used in The Graveyard and The Asylum Grounds. In the MediEvil 0.32 Demo, the track was used in The Graveyard, Cemetery Hill, and the Stained Glass Demon's boss fight.

1G1A (Demo)

Template:Infobox songA shorter version of 1G1A (Dan's Awakening). In the MediEvil Rolling Demo, the track was used for The Ant Caves, The Sleeping Village, and Pools of the Ancient Dead. This track was not used in the MediEvil 0.32 Demo but can be located within the game files.

1G2A (Demo)

Template:Infobox songA shorter version of 1G2A (Quest for Vengeance). In the MediEvil Rolling Demo, the track was used in Scarecrow Fields and Pumpkin Gorge levels. In the MediEvil 0.32 Demo, the track was used in The Hilltop Mausoleum.
